New York Mets NL East Preview

by Abe Luciano on Thursday, March 6th, 2008

The NY Mets finished their season in complete free-fall blowing a 7 game lead with 17 games left to finish in second place in the NL East. But heading into their last season at Shea Stadium, the Mets are the odds on favorite to win the division. Sportsbetting has the NY Mets as 5-1 MLB betting odds to win the World Series.

The Mets iffy pitching staff landed the biggest fish in free-agency by signing a legitimate staff ace in Johan Santana. Santana will be joined by solid veterans Pedro Martinez, John Main and Oliver Perez who are all quality MLB starters. The bullpen is shaky with closer Billy Wagner not what he once was, and the rest of the pen being suspect at best. Catching shouldn’t be a problem however, with top-notch defensive receiver Brian Schneider handling the staff. Sportsbetting has the New York Mets as 2-1 MLB betting odds to win the NL Pennant.

 New York Mets NL East PreviewThe Mets have firepower in their lineup but durability could be a major concern with creaky vets Carlos Delgado, Moises Alou and Luis Castillo. All three are still solid ballplayers but getting 100 games out of each is about all you can expect. In their primes however are elite players like David Wright, Jose Reyes and Carlos Beltran who give NY muscle to put runs on the board. Wright is especially dangerous with the bat coming off an MVP like year that saw him hit .325 with 30 HR’s and 107 RBI’s. Sportsbetting has the NY Mets 2-5 odds to win the NL East Pennant.

If the Mets stay reasonably healthy and the pitching lives up to expectations NY is the team to beat and could easily improve on last year's 88-74 record.
